MAX232DW RS232 Transceiver Equivalent & Substitute Parts
Part Overview
The MAX232DW is a 2/2 full-duplex RS232 transceiver in 16-SOIC surface mount packaging, manufactured by Texas Instruments. This component is classified as obsolete, making equivalent and substitute parts necessary for ongoing design support and production continuity. The MAX232DW operates within a 4.5V to 5.5V supply voltage range with a 120 kbps data rate and 500 mV receiver hysteresis, serving as a standard interface IC for RS232 serial communication applications.

Key Parameters
| Parameter | MAX232DW Specification |
|---|---|
| Manufacturer | Texas Instruments |
| Type | Transceiver |
| Protocol | RS232 |
| Number of Drivers/Receivers | 2/2 |
| Duplex | Full |
| Receiver Hysteresis | 500 mV |
| Data Rate | 120 Kbps |
| Voltage - Supply | 4.5V ~ 5.5V |
| Operating Temperature | 0°C ~ 70°C |
| Mounting Type | Surface Mount |
| Package / Case | 16-SOIC (0.295", 7.50mm Width) |
| RoHS Status | ROHS3 Compliant |
| Moisture Sensitivity Level (MSL) | 1 (Unlimited) |
| Product Status | Obsolete |
Substitute Part Grouping Explanation
Substitution of the MAX232DW is determined by strict adherence to the following electrical and mechanical parameters:
Critical Matching Parameters:
- Protocol: RS232
- Number of Drivers/Receivers: 2/2
- Duplex: Full
- Voltage - Supply: 4.5V ~ 5.5V
- Mounting Type: Surface Mount
- Package / Case: 16-SOIC (0.295", 7.50mm Width)
Allowable Variation Parameters:
- Receiver Hysteresis: 400 mV to 650 mV (within functional tolerance)
- Data Rate: 120 Kbps minimum (higher rates acceptable)
- Operating Temperature: Extended ranges acceptable for industrial applications
- Product Status: Active preferred over obsolete
- Packaging Format: Tube, Cut Tape (CT) & Digi-Reel®, or Tape & Reel (TR) all acceptable
Substitute parts are grouped by manufacturer and product line while maintaining full electrical and mechanical compatibility with the original MAX232DW specification.
Parameter Comparison
| Part Number | Manufacturer | Protocol | Drivers/Receivers | Duplex | Receiver Hysteresis | Data Rate | Supply Voltage | Operating Temp | Package | Product Status | Packaging Format |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| MAX232DW | Texas Instruments | RS232 | 2/2 | Full | 500 mV | 120 Kbps | 4.5V ~ 5.5V | 0°C ~ 70°C | 16-SOIC | Obsolete | Tube |
| MAX232IDWR | Texas Instruments | RS232 | 2/2 | Full | 500 mV | 120 Kbps | 4.5V ~ 5.5V | -40°C ~ 85°C | 16-SOIC | Active | Cut Tape (CT) & Digi-Reel® |
| MAX232CWE+T | Analog Devices Inc./Maxim Integrated | RS232 | 2/2 | Full | 500 mV | 120 Kbps | 4.5V ~ 5.5V | 0°C ~ 70°C | 16-SOIC | Active | Cut Tape (CT) & Digi-Reel® |
| MAX232EEWE+ | Analog Devices Inc./Maxim Integrated | RS232 | 2/2 | Full | 500 mV | 120 Kbps | 4.5V ~ 5.5V | -40°C ~ 85°C | 16-SOIC | Active | Tube |
| MAX232EWE+ | Analog Devices Inc./Maxim Integrated | RS232 | 2/2 | Full | 500 mV | 120 Kbps | 4.5V ~ 5.5V | -40°C ~ 85°C | 16-SOIC | Active | Tube |
| HIN232CBZ-T | Renesas Electronics Corporation | RS232 | 2/2 | Full | 500 mV | 120 Kbps | 4.5V ~ 5.5V | 0°C ~ 70°C | 16-SOIC | Active | Cut Tape (CT) & Digi-Reel® |
| ADM202EARWZ | Analog Devices Inc. | RS232 | 2/2 | Full | 650 mV | 230 kbps | 4.5V ~ 5.5V | -40°C ~ 85°C | 16-SOIC | Active | Tube |
| ADM202EARWZ-REEL | Analog Devices Inc. | RS232 | 2/2 | Full | 650 mV | 230 kbps | 4.5V ~ 5.5V | -40°C ~ 85°C | 16-SOIC | Active | Tape & Reel (TR) |
| ADM202JRWZ | Analog Devices Inc. | RS232 | 2/2 | Full | 400 mV | — | 4.5V ~ 5.5V | 0°C ~ 70°C | 16-SOIC | Active | Tube |
| ADM202JRWZ-REEL | Analog Devices Inc. | RS232 | 2/2 | Full | 400 mV | — | 4.5V ~ 5.5V | 0°C ~ 70°C | 16-SOIC | Active | Tape & Reel (TR) |
| ADM232AARNZ | UMW | RS232 | 2/2 | Full | — | 120 Kbps | 4.5V ~ 5.5V | -40°C ~ 85°C | 16-SOP | Active | Cut Tape (CT) & Digi-Reel® |
Engineering Selection Recommendations
Direct Substitutes (Identical Operating Temperature Range):
MAX232CWE+T and HIN232CBZ-T are direct functional equivalents to the MAX232DW, maintaining the 0°C to 70°C operating temperature range with identical electrical specifications. Both are active products with ROHS3 compliance and REACH unaffected status. MAX232CWE+T is available in Cut Tape format with 5,893 units in stock, while HIN232CBZ-T offers the highest inventory availability at 10,400 units.
Extended Temperature Range Substitutes:
MAX232IDWR, MAX232EEWE+, and MAX232EWE+ extend the operating temperature range to -40°C to 85°C while maintaining all other electrical parameters. These are suitable for applications requiring industrial temperature specifications. MAX232IDWR is the manufacturer-recommended substitute from Texas Instruments in Cut Tape format. MAX232EEWE+ and MAX232EWE+ are available in Tube packaging from Analog Devices Inc./Maxim Integrated.
Enhanced Performance Substitutes:
ADM202EARWZ and ADM202EARWZ-REEL provide increased data rate capability (230 kbps versus 120 kbps) and extended operating temperature range (-40°C to 85°C). Receiver hysteresis is specified at 650 mV, within acceptable tolerance. These are manufacturer-recommended alternatives with 1,600 and 2,021 units in stock respectively.
Temperature-Matched Alternative:
ADM202JRWZ and ADM202JRWZ-REEL maintain the 0°C to 70°C operating temperature range with 400 mV receiver hysteresis. These are active products suitable for applications matching the original thermal specification.
Package Variant:
ADM232AARNZ from UMW is available in 16-SOP (0.154", 3.90mm Width) packaging, differing from the standard 16-SOIC footprint. This variant is suitable only for designs with compatible PCB layouts and is not recommended as a direct drop-in replacement without board redesign.
All substitute parts maintain ROHS3 compliance and EAR99 export classification consistent with the original MAX232DW.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Can MAX232IDWR be used as a direct replacement for MAX232DW?
A: Yes. MAX232IDWR is the manufacturer-recommended substitute from Texas Instruments. It maintains identical electrical specifications (2/2 RS232 transceiver, 500 mV hysteresis, 120 kbps data rate, 4.5V to 5.5V supply) and 16-SOIC packaging. The extended operating temperature range (-40°C to 85°C versus 0°C to 70°C) provides additional capability without compromising compatibility.
Q: What is the difference between MAX232CWE+T and MAX232EEWE+?
A: Both are Analog Devices Inc./Maxim Integrated MAX232 variants with identical electrical specifications. MAX232CWE+T is supplied in Cut Tape (CT) & Digi-Reel® format with 0°C to 70°C operating range, while MAX232EEWE+ is supplied in Tube format with extended -40°C to 85°C operating range. Selection depends on packaging requirements and thermal specifications of the application.
Q: Is HIN232CBZ-T from Renesas a suitable substitute?
A: Yes. HIN232CBZ-T is a direct functional equivalent with identical electrical specifications to MAX232DW (2/2 RS232, 500 mV hysteresis, 120 kbps, 0°C to 70°C). It is an active product with the highest inventory availability (10,400 units) and maintains ROHS3 compliance. Packaging is Cut Tape (CT) & Digi-Reel® format.
Q: Can ADM202EARWZ replace MAX232DW in all applications?
A: ADM202EARWZ is electrically compatible with enhanced specifications: 230 kbps data rate (versus 120 kbps) and extended temperature range (-40°C to 85°C). The 650 mV receiver hysteresis is within acceptable tolerance. It is suitable for applications where higher data rates or industrial temperature ranges are beneficial or required. Verify application requirements before substitution.
Q: Why is ADM232AARNZ listed as a substitute if the package differs?
A: ADM232AARNZ is included for reference as an active alternative from UMW with compatible electrical specifications. However, the 16-SOP package (0.154", 3.90mm Width) differs from the standard 16-SOIC footprint (0.295", 7.50mm Width). This part is not suitable as a direct drop-in replacement and requires PCB redesign. It is listed only for applications where package redesign is feasible.
